About the role

The Senior Director position at the Greater Philadelphia YMCA is a unique opportunity to directly impact the lives of members and communities through effective member services.

Responsibilities

  • Recruit, train, schedule, supervise, develop and track certifications of staff to deliver high quality programs and services that respond to member needs.
  • Manage the daily operations and personnel of assigned departments, including Membership, Sports, Summer Camp, and Kid Zone.
  • Ensure adherence to association membership quality standards.
  • Ensure staff training and development is continuous.
  • Ensure delivery of high-quality services that exceed member expectations.
  • Oversee the development and implementation of improvement plans, membership committees and retention strategies.
  • Develop and implement community outreach to serve more membership in the community.
  • Cultivate relationships with community groups which should include Community Partners, Corporate Partners, Special Target Populations, Service Organizations, etc.
  • Establish achievable monthly member’s goals and projections for branch membership growth utilizing sales and retention strategies.
  • Monitor member feedback to assess membership service effectiveness.
  • Seek additional funding sources through successful new member acquisition strategies that fit the non-profit nature of the Y.
  • Provide leadership to new membership initiatives for the branch.
  • Seek membership expansion utilizing off-site partners or social media strategies.
  • Provide branch coordination with all departments to ensure successful communication, special events and program growth.
